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Tamworth to Reading Green Park start from £60.90 one way, or £73.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Tamworth to Reading Green Park are available for £75.90 one way, or £151.70 return

Facilities and Amenities at Tamworth Station

When visiting Tamworth Station, you will find a well-equipped ticket office that operates from 06:10 to 20:00 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 09:15 to 16:45 on Sundays. If you need to collect tickets purchased online, you can conveniently use the accessible ticket machines located at the station front. These machines are designed to cater to all users, with an induction loop system available for those with hearing impairments.

Accessibility is a key feature here with step-free access throughout the station, making it easy to move around. There are accessible toilets, a seating area, and wheelchairs available on-site. While there is no waiting room office, the presence of customer help points ensures assistance is never far away. Moreover, public Wi-Fi might not be available, but you can use pay phones if needed. For cyclist enthusiasts, bicycle storage is provided on Platform 1.

Connect Beyond the Station

If your journey requires onward connections, Tamworth Station offers seamless links. Taxis are readily available from several local firms including Bennetts and Tamworth's own services. For those preferring buses, essential information for planning further travel is available here. In case of any rail disruptions, replacement buses are on standby at the station entrance.

Parking and Refreshments

The station’s parking facilities are managed by SABA UK, with 323 spaces including 10 accessible ones, ensuring ample parking whatever your arrival time. Charges apply, and they vary from daily to annual rates, with conveniences allowing you to pay via the Saba Parking UK app or pay-on-foot machines. Refreshment facilities are available to keep you energized but note the absence of ATM machines and shops.

Station Amenities and Facilities

Reading Green Park station boasts a mix of practical and essential facilities designed to enhance your travel experience. If purchasing or collecting tickets is on your agenda, you'll be pleased to find the ticket machines available for use. The station is open for ticket sales from 06:45 to 18:15 on weekdays, and from 10:15 to 16:45 on Sundays. Additionally, an induction loop is available for easier communication for those with hearing impairments.

While there aren't a plethora of shops or dining options within the station, you can rely on the "GWR Free Station WiFi" to stay connected while you wait for your train. Amenities like luggage storage aren't available, but CCTV ensures security within the premises.

Support and Accessibility

Accessibility is a priority at Reading Green Park. With step-free access throughout the station, those with mobility challenges can navigate with ease. While the station provides ramps for train access and accessible ticket machines, it does not have accessible toilets or an impaired mobility set-down area. However, for any assistance needed, staff are available from 06:30 to 18:30 every day. Have questions? Help points are stationed around the site to provide information and assistance.

Onward Travel and Transport Connections

Your journey doesn't stop at the station, with several onward travel options available to complement your train ride. Located conveniently on the station forecourt, bus stops facilitate access to local areas, and a taxi rank is positioned at the front of the station for more immediate travel needs.
